We all know the traditional application of the archimedean screw pump where water is pumped up from a lower to a higher level. The reversal of its function provides an efficient means of saving energy. The main advantage of a screw pump is that it is taylor made to the specific installation and therefore extremely efficient for a wide range.
The new range of the Landustrie screw pump covers the hydropower screw. An efficient use of water power is already achieved at a level difference of 1 meter and a capacity of 500 l/sec. The largest capacity and level difference for hydropower screws is as much as 15000 l/sec. at 10 meter.
Benefits of hydropower screws:
highest efficiency (up to 86%)
simple installation
easy implementation in existing situations (no civil construction work)
extremely fish friendly
insensitive to clogging
low maintenance costs
long life time
improvement of water quality
24/24 energy supply
active flow control without extra losses
possibility to switch over to pump function
self-regulating to changing water flow
